#192bcd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#192bcd is composed of 9.8% red, 16.9%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.8% cyan, 79%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 234 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 45.1%. #192bcd color hex could be obtained by blending #3256ff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#192bcd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030d is the darkest color, while #fafb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#192bcd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717275 is the less saturated color, while #071ddf is the most saturated one.
